    ‘The Fly’ Gangster Faces Formal Investigation Immediately After Returning to France

    ‘The Fly’ gangster placed under formal investigation upon arrival back in France – France 24
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email Copy Link Tumblr Reddit VKontakte Telegram WhatsApp

    The notorious figure known as “The Fly,” a key player in France’s criminal underworld, has been placed under formal investigation shortly after his return to the country. French authorities swiftly moved to detain the gangster, whose activities have long been linked to organized crime and violent offenses. The developments mark a significant turn in the ongoing crackdown on illicit networks operating within France, as investigators seek to unravel the full extent of his alleged criminal enterprises.

    The Fly Gangster Detained on Return to France Amid Heightened Legal Scrutiny

    The arrest of the notorious criminal figure known by his alias “The Fly” occurred immediately upon his return to France, signaling a significant escalation in the ongoing investigation. French judicial authorities have taken swift action following his arrival at Charles de Gaulle Airport, detaining him under suspicion of involvement in organized crime activities. Investigators are reportedly focusing on his alleged role in orchestrating cross-border criminal operations, which have drawn international attention and intensified legal scrutiny.
